Last week, ousted Grammys CEO Deborah Dugan took to the Grammys with a sledgehammer, alleging in an equal opportunity complaint that the Recording Academy is rife with rampant sexual misconduct, voter fraud, and racialised and gendered bias. It was a document that has already changed the music industry in a profound and irreversible way, and that probably will continue to do so in the future.

Netflix is starting to lift the veil on its viewership numbers and the methods by which it arrives at those numbers. The streaming service still keeps most of his data close to the chest, of course, but there are occasions when the site sheds some light on what subscribers are watching, particularly when those numbers are impressive.
